          Hi Tamarind, do you know if this Knex toy is more for building cars ? cos i see mostly cars and planes boxes. I am thinking to get the value tub, i think now on offer 18.99. What can this knex build actually ? i mean if not building cars etc ? DS is not into cars so i wonder if i get knex will he be able to build other stuff ?


          thanks
          I bought this set for my boy :
          K'NEX Education: Intro to Simple Machines: Gears
          http://www.knex.com/Shop/product.php?productid=16802

          K'NEX Education: Intro to Simple Machines: Wheels, Axles and Inclined Planes
          http://www.knex.com/educational_toys/to_simple_machines_wheels_axles_inclined_planes.php

          He can make many models of real world machines from these sets, not only cars. These sets are very educational even for adults. Recommended age is 8+, but my boy can play them independently at 6 years old. I bought these sets from amazon using direct shipping.

                      tamarind:
                      insider,

                      If you intend to buy KNEX for childcare centers, note that the parts in the sets that I recommended are very small, not suitable for young kids who tend to swallow things. The recommended age is 8+ for those sets. I bought for my boy when he just turned 6 years old because we don't have younger kids around.

                      KNEX has other sets for younger kids :
                      http://www.knex.com/Shop/theme_search.php?searchType=skill&subType=pre-school

                        tamarind:


                        We have the GeoTrax train system :

                        http://www.fisher-price.com/fp.aspx?st=5750&e=products

                        The quality is very good, and the pieces are big, suitable for 3 years old. It is sold in local department stores.

                        If you buy more train tracks, the child can think of new designs to construct. It is a good introduction to construction toys.
